CAF Bank home page

Helping charities to make a better society

Skip to content

Not Authorized

Sorry, you do not have permission to access this page
Go to Home Page

CAF Bank Limited company registration number 1837656 (England and Wales). CAF Bank Limited is authorised by the Prudential Regulation Authority and regulated by the Financial Conduct Authority and the Prudential Regulation Authority (FRN 204451).

Version: 9.24.04.0001